Effectiveness of Intravitreal Bevacizumab (Avastin™) in Vitreous Hemorrhage Associated with Proliferative Diabetic Retinopathy

Proliferative diabetic retinopathy (PDR) is a major cause of vision loss in diabetic patients. Vitreous haemorrhage (VH) is a common complication of PDR that significantly affects visual acuity. Intravitreal bevacizumab (Avastin™) has been used as a treatment option for VH associated with PDR. Objectives: To determine the effectiveness of intravitreal bevacizumab (Avastin™) in clearing vitreous haemorrhage and improving visual acuity in patients with PDR. Methods: This quasi-experimental study was conducted at the Ophthalmology Department, Hayatabad Medical Complex, Peshawar, from 01-01-2025 to 30-06-2025. A total of 79 patients with PDR-associated VH were included. Patients received three intravitreal bevacizumab injections at monthly intervals. Outcomes included VH clearance, improvement in best corrected visual acuity (BCVA), and requirement of pars plana vitrectomy. Data were analysed using SPSS version 22.0. Paired sample t-test and Chi-square test were applied, with p≤0.05 considered statistically significant. Results: The mean age of participants was 41.49 ± 10.54 years. VH clearance was observed in 67 (84.8%) patients, while improvement in BCVA occurred in 57 (72.2%) patients. Pars plana vitrectomy was required in 14 (17.7%) patients.
